Freecodecamp Steamroller
const steamrollArray = (arr, finalArr = []) => {
arr.forEach(elem => {
if(Array.isArray(elem)){
steamrollArray(elem, finalArr)
}
else{
finalArr.push(elem)
}
});
return finalArr
}
const ans = steamrollArray([1, [], [3, [[4]]]]);
console.log(ans)